BR500-P Solar Pump Inverter Overview
The ZK500-P series powers three-phase or single-phase AC pumps using solar DC input. Built on the reliable ZK500 VFD platform, it features MPPT, rapid speed adjustment in low sunlight, and flexible pump compatibility—supporting both DC/AC input and 1/3-phase output.

Specifications BR500-P Solar Pump Inverter
Item | Specifications | |
Input | Rated Voltage/Frequency | 80-450VDC for D1 110V pumps, 0.75KW-2.2KW
150-450VDC for D2 220V pumps, 0.75KW-2.2KW 250-800VDC for D3 380V pumps, 0.75KW-500KW AC and DC hybrid input |
Recommended MPPT voltage(VDC) | 1S series: Vmp 131 to 350 VDC
2S series: Vmp 280 to 375VDC 4T series: Vmp 450 to 780 VDC/ Max 900VDC is optional |

VFD Efficiency | above 96% | |
MPPT Efficiency | above 99.6% | |
Power factor | above 0.94( with DC reactor) | |
Allowable Variablerange | Voltage:-20%~+20%, Frequency:±5% | |
Output | Rated Voltage | 0~110V 220V 380V 480V |
Frequency Resolution | 0.01Hz | |
Overload capacity | 150% 1 minute;180% 10 second;200% 0.5 second | |
Basic Functions | Motor type | permanent magnet servo motor and asynchronous motor pumps. |
Solar pump control special performance | MPPT ( maximum power point tracking), CVT (constant voltage tracking), auto/manual operation,
dry run protection, low stop frequency protection, minimum power input, motor maximum current protection, flow calculating, energy generated calculating |

VFD funciton when AC grid input | Automatic voltage regulation (AVR),Overvoltage and overspeed loss control,Fast current limiting function,When the grid voltage changes, it can automatically keep the output voltage constant,Automatically limits current and voltage during operation to prevent frequent overcurrent and overvoltage trip,Minimize overcurrent faults and protect the normal operation of the product | |
Running mode | MPPT , CVT, variable frequency mode | |
Communication | RS485 Standard Interface,supporting two formats MODBUS protocol | |
Kinds of Protection functions | Over Current protection;Over Voltage protection;Under Voltage protection; Over heat protection;Overload protection | |
Short circuit detection, overcurrent protection, overvoltage protection, undervoltage protection, overheat protection and overload protection of electrified motor | ||
Environment | Altitude | Below 1000m; above 1000m, derated 1% for every additional 100m. |
temperature | -10℃~+50℃ | |
Ambient temperature | Less than 90%RH, no water condenses | |
Vibration | Less than 5.9m/sec 2(0.6G) | |
Storage temperature | -30℃~+60℃ | |
Structure | Level of Protection | standard IP20, operation IP54 IP55 |
Cooling-down method | Forced air cooling | |
Installation | Indoor, ,free from direct sunlight, dust, corrosive gas,Oiliness gas, water vapour |
